Transaction 4328ed117fe16e722275b267989c32d0f606aa554855737e5052e3fcaa10f30e

1 Input
2 Outputs
  • 4328ed117fe16e722275b267989c32d0f606aa554855737e5052e3fcaa10f30e:0
  • value  333667
    address  3MRkFGZhXZZdWo6dtGJk7hwfmPv6AqjCnx
  • 4328ed117fe16e722275b267989c32d0f606aa554855737e5052e3fcaa10f30e:1
  • value  2986557
    address  38bMnSkFAyRnxKULYtmsR5JkykkzRHMW33